What is a Plastic Pouch Making Machine?

A plastic pouch making machine is an automated device designed to produce various types of flexible packaging bags from plastic films. These machines typically use processes such as film feeding, forming, sealing, and cutting to create bags that are suitable for a wide range of applications, from food packaging to pharmaceuticals. Modern machines can be semi-automatic or fully automatic, with the latter offering a higher degree of automation and efficiency.

Types and Models of Plastic Pouch Making Machines

There are several types of plastic pouch making machines, each with its own set of features and capabilities. Understanding these differences can help you choose the right machine for your specific requirements.


Pre-made Pouch Packaging Machines

Pre-made pouch machines are designed to handle pre-formed pouches for filling and sealing. These machines are flexible and can handle a variety of pouch shapes and sizes, making them ideal for businesses that need to work with multiple products. The key advantage of pre-made machines is their versatility and quick changeover time, although they are generally suited to lower production volumes compared to form fill and seal machines.


Form Fill and Seal Machines

Form fill and seal machines are designed to create pouches from roll stock film, fill them with product, and then seal them. These machines are highly efficient and can handle high-volume production. They are typically used in industries that require consistent, high-speed packaging, such as food packaging or pharmaceuticals. Form fill and seal machines are less flexible in terms of changing pouch designs but excel in speed and efficiency.


Three-Side Seal Pouch Machines

Three-side seal machines are designed to produce pouches with a seal on three sides, usually leaving the top side open for filling or zipping. These machines are ideal for single-serve food packaging, liquid or powder sachets, and medical wipes. They are known for their precision in heat sealing and the ability to handle a variety of materials like PET/PE, PET/AL/PE, and BOPP/CPP.


Stand-Up Pouch Machines

Stand-up pouch machines create pouches that stand on their own when filled, such as snack packs, pet food pouches, and coffee sachets. These machines feature a bottom gusset former, top and bottom seal zones, and optional zipper insertion modules. Stand-up pouch machines are versatile and can produce a wide range of pouch designs, making them popular in the food and pet food industries.


Bottom Seal Bag Machines

Bottom seal bag machines produce pouches with a seal at the bottom and an open top for filling. These machines are ideal for grocery bags, industrial linens, and supermarket roll bags. They are known for their high-speed operation, producing up to 400 bags per minute. Bottom seal bag machines are commonly used in industries that require a large volume of bags with consistent quality.


Side Weld Bag Machines

Side weld machines produce pouches with a seal on the side, either mono-extruded or co-extruded. These machines are known for their precision in weld stations and inline punching or die-cutting capabilities. They are commonly used in the production of garment bags, hospital pouches, and hygiene product wrappers. Side weld machines offer a high level of customization and are suitable for a range of materials.

Investment and Economic Analysis

Before making a decision on which plastic pouch making machine to purchase, it's important to perform a comprehensive economic analysis to understand the return on investment (ROI).


Initial Purchase Costs

The initial cost of a plastic pouch making machine varies based on the model and specifications. For example, semi-automatic models are generally more affordable, while fully automated machines can cost significantly more. Here's a rough breakdown of different models and their typical price ranges:


  • Pre-made Pouch Packaging Machine: $10,000 - $25,000
  • Form Fill and Seal Machine: $20,000 - $50,000
  • Three-Side Seal Pouch Machine: $15,000 - $35,000
  • Stand-Up Pouch Machine: $30,000 - $60,000
  • Bottom Seal Bag Machine: $10,000 - $35,000
  • Side Weld Bag Machine: $15,000 - $40,000

Operating Costs

Operating costs include ongoing expenses such as electricity, maintenance, labor, and consumables. These costs differ based on the model and usage:


  • Electricity: An average fully automatic machine consumes around $1,000 per month in electricity.
  • Maintenance: Regular maintenance reduces downtime and ensures efficient operation. Semi-automatic models require less frequent maintenance compared to fully automated machines, which may require more frequent servicing due to their complexity.
  • Labor: The cost of labor depends on the required skills and work hours. Highly automated machines may require fewer operators compared to semi-automatic models, reducing labor costs.
  • Consumables: Materials such as films and inks are a significant part of the ongoing costs. Efficient raw material use is key to reducing these expenses.

Return on Investment (ROI)

Calculating ROI involves assessing the balance between the initial investment and the revenue generated over time. The ROI for different models varies based on production volume, efficiency, and customizability. As a rough estimate:


  • Volume: High-volume production significantly impacts ROI, as it reduces the spread of fixed costs over a greater number of units.
  • Efficiency: Fully automated machines are more efficient and can produce higher volumes, leading to better ROI.
  • Customizability: Machines that offer more customization options (like zippers, spouts, and various sealing methods) can attract a wider range of customers and generate more diverse revenue streams.
